The Multifunctional Baby Stroller Market size was estimated at USD 2.40 billion in 2025 and expected to reach USD 2.52 billion in 2026, at a CAGR of 5.07% to reach USD 3.39 billion by 2032.

Uncovering deep insights across product types, price tiers, sales channels, age groups, feature sets, and material selections for stroller segmentation
Insight into consumer preferences and product performance can be deeply enriched by examining multiple segmentation dimensions concurrently. When viewed through the lens of product type, all-terrain configurations-available in both four-wheel and three-wheel variants-deliver superior adaptability across uneven surfaces, whereas joggers with single and double-wheel options cater to fitness-focused caregivers seeking stability at higher speeds. Lightweight designs range from full-size to ultra-light profiles, emphasizing ease of transport for urban commuters. Modular systems extend functionality through convertible seating and interchangeable modules that support growing families. Travel-compatible strollers offer models with and without car seat compatibility, ensuring seamless parent-and-baby transitions, while umbrella strollers balance compact portability with standard stability.
Delving into price range segmentation reveals that economy-level offerings, spanning basic and entry-level options, are capturing value-driven buyers, while mid-range products-priced between two hundred to three hundred and three hundred to five hundred dollars-appeal to aspirational consumers balancing features and affordability. Premium solutions, encompassing upper-mid to luxury tiers, emphasize high-end materials, designer aesthetics, and advanced features like reversible seating and one-hand folding. Sales channel analysis highlights that offline distribution through baby boutiques, specialty stores, supermarkets, hypermarkets, and toy shops remains vital for in-person demonstrations, even as online channels-including brand websites, e-commerce marketplaces, and social commerce platforms-drive convenience-led purchases.
Age group segmentation underscores distinct developmental needs from newborn to six months, six to twelve months, and one to three years, guiding ergonomic design choices and accessory offerings. Feature-based differentiation-such as adjustable handles, car seat compatibility, one-hand fold mechanisms, and reversible seating-addresses evolving caregiver demands for functionality and comfort. Material type segmentation further refines product positioning, with aluminum frame constructions delivering lightweight durability, steel frames offering robust load-bearing capacity, and plastic components enabling cost-effective design flexibility.

Examining regional dynamics driving stroller adoption across the Americas, Europe, Middle East & Africa, and the fast-growing Asia-Pacific markets
The Americas region continues to lead in adoption of multifunctional stroller innovations, driven by strong consumer emphasis on premium convenience and a robust retail infrastructure encompassing both brick-and-mortar and digital touchpoints. North American and Latin American caregivers are displaying heightened interest in travel system compatibility and sustainable manufacturing practices, underpinning the expansion of localized production facilities to serve regional demand.
In Europe, Middle East & Africa, regulatory standards around child safety and environmental sustainability are guiding product development, with manufacturers investing in advanced restraint systems, recyclable materials, and energy-efficient assembly practices. Western European markets are witnessing rising uptake of modular and convertible designs, while Middle Eastern and African consumers are exploring cost-effective lightweight and umbrella models to navigate diverse urban and rural environments.
The Asia-Pacific region is characterized by rapid urbanization, burgeoning middle-class populations, and a strong e-commerce ecosystem that has accelerated online stroller sales. China, Japan, and Australia are at the forefront of demand for high-performance jogging and all-terrain categories, prompting global brands to tailor offerings for local preferences, including compact foldability for confined living spaces and enhanced suspension for variable terrain.

Profiling leading manufacturers and innovators shaping competition through design excellence and strategic market positioning
The competitive arena for multifunctional baby strollers is populated by a combination of global conglomerates and specialized innovators. Established players like Graco and Chicco have consolidated their market presence through extensive dealer networks and brand loyalty, emphasizing comprehensive travel-system ecosystems and rigorous safety compliance. Boutique brands such as UPPAbaby and Bugaboo differentiate through premium design aesthetics and advanced suspension engineering, positioning themselves at the upper end of the market spectrum.
Meanwhile, fitness-oriented specialists like Baby Jogger maintain a strong foothold in the jogging stroller category, leveraging patented wheel technologies and lightweight chassis. Emerging contenders including Nuna and Cybex focus on integrating digital safety features and modular adaptability, targeting tech-savvy consumers seeking seamless interoperability with smart devices. These key market participants continue to invest in product innovation, strategic partnerships, and targeted marketing initiatives to capture evolving consumer segments and expand their global footprint.
